Monday, April 15th 2019 Dear Members of Congress:

On behalf of our organizations and the millions
of American individuals, families, and business
owners they represent, we urge you to focus on comprehensive reforms
to prioritize, streamline and innovate the financing and regulation of our nation’s
infrastructure projects rather than considering any increases to the federal
gas tax.

As part of any potential infrastructure package, Congress
has an opportunity this year to institute major
reforms to our federal
funding and regulatory systems. Reforms
are badly needed
to improve outcomes, target spending toward
critical projects, and streamline much needed maintenance and construction projects.
The goal this year should
be a more modern and efficient
national infrastructure system that will allow people
and goods to move where they need to both safely and economically,
contributing to an effective and well-functioning system of free enterprise.

A 25-cent per gallon increase
in the federal gas tax, a current
proposal from some on and off Capitol
Hill, would more than double the current rate and would amount to an estimated
$394 billion tax increase over the next ten years.

Before asking Americans for more of their hard earned money
at the gas pump, lawmakers must consider how federal gas tax
dollars are currently mishandled. More than 28 percent
of funds from the Highway
Trust Fund are currently diverted away from roads and bridges. Still more taxpayer
dollars are wasted on inflated
costs due to outdated regulatory burdens, a complex
and sluggish permitting system, and overly restrictive labor requirements.

These reforms can be achieved by focusing on three core outcomes: 1) spending smarter on projects of true national priority, 2) reforming outdated and costly regulations, and 3) protecting Americans from new or increased tax burdens.

We urge lawmakers to reject calls to simply
throw more money into a broken funding
system. Now is the time to take serious steps toward modernizing our nation’s
infrastructure by eliminating unnecessary spending, reducing
government overreach and unleashing untapped private sector
investment. Our organizations stand ready to work with lawmakers who will fight
for these important reforms
to deliver better
results to the American people
without asking them to pay more.
